The Philippines Consults on New Regulatory Guidelines for Food Contact Articles for Prepackaged Processed Food Products

The Philippines FDA's draft General Guidelines on FCAs aim to prevent chemical migration in prepackaged processed foods, mandating Food Business Operators to certify packaging suitability.

On February 3, 2026, the Philippines Food and Drug Administration (FDA) published the draft General Guidelines on the Regulatory Compliance of Food Contact Articles (FCA) Used for Prepackaged Processed Food Products. The proposal aims to mandate safety standards preventing chemical migration and requires Food Business Operators (FBOs) to verify the suitability of their packaging materials through certification. Industry stakeholders are invited to submit comments on the draft Guidelines by March 4, 2026.
